Ideal Substrates for Fungi Growing
Selecting the appropriate substrate is critical for successful fungi production. Many options are available , each with their specific qualities. Common choices include grain which offers ample ventilation and is often relatively affordable . Hardwood pellets provide a denser medium ideal for specific varieties and offer superb nutritional benefit. Coconut fiber is also ever more employed due to its substantial moisture retention and pH characteristics . In conclusion, the best medium depends on the specific fungi strain you are producing.
